SB302- Compassionate Access to Medical Cannabis Act

We should not be drug-testing seniors for cannabis use and forcing them to switch to more severe treatments for ALS or dementia, like opioids and anti-psychotics, as a precondition of receiving healthcare. Today’s unanimous bipartisan vote gives our most vulnerable the dignity they deserve: access to care. It’s not fair that 25 year olds are allowed to seek jobs and obtain healthcare while using cannabis but 75 year olds cannot. If you are 65+, ill and in a healthcare facility no one should stop you from consuming medical cannabis to manage your suffering. I am grateful to my colleagues for prioritizing this immediate need for equity in cannabis for all people no matter how old or where they live.

 

 

Senator Henry Stern was elected to the California State Senate in November of 2016. He represents the diverse constituents of the 27th district that includes just under half of Ventura County and parts of Los Angeles County. Senator Stern has worked tirelessly as a fierce advocate for the 27th district on important issues such as the environment, clean energy, wildfire mitigation, housing, mental healthcare, and public safety throughout his community.
